× Linguagem de Programação ADVPL

Perguntas Acessar Banco de Dados em outro Servidor - TCLINK()

Mais
9 anos 1 mês atrás #27480 por italo
Opa pessoal!

Preciso acessar um banco de dados em SQL SERVER de um sistema diferente do Protheus localizado em outro servidor.

Estou tentando usar a função TCLINK, mas não estou conseguindo:

User Function Teste()
Local cDBOra := "SERVIDOR2/SISTEMA"
Local cSrvOra := "192.168.254.10"
Local nHndOra
nHndOra := TcLink(cDbOra,cSrvOra,7890)
If nHndOra < 0
UserException("Erro ("+srt(nHndOra,4)+") ao conectar com "+cDbOra+" em "+cSrvOra)
Endif
conout("conectado - Handler"+str(nHndOra,4))
TcUnlink(nHndOra)
conout("desconectado.")
Return

O SQL Server no outro servidor possui senha, é necessário informar na função acima? Se sim, como?


Italo Dantas

Por favor Acessar ou Registrar para participar da conversa.

Mais
9 anos 1 mês atrás #27499 por henry.charriere
Italo, boa tarde!

É para relatório? Alguma coisa diferente?


Atenciosamente,
Henry

Por favor Acessar ou Registrar para participar da conversa.

Tempo para a criação da página:0.099 segundos
Joomla templates by a4joomla